FRENCH FLINTLOCK INDIAN TRADE FUSIL CIRCA 1760’S.
Description: FRENCH FLINTLOCK INDIAN TRADE FUSIL CIRCA 1760’S. 57” overall with 42” octagon/round .65 caliber smoothbore barrel. Full length stock with brass mounts. Stock with “Bell Flower” trade style carving about the tang and “Arrowhead” trigger guard finial . Lightly engraved butt plate and side plate. All original and in original flint with all the original lock parts. Stock with the original patinated finish Metal a dark grey patina. Original wood ramrod. Working order. Superior example of a typical French Trade Fusil of the pre Revolutionary War period with many of their type traded for furs to Indian tribes from the Allegheny mountains to the Rockies.
